We are pleased to welcome to the market this one bedroom ground floor maisonette located in a quiet cul-de-sac close to Romsey Town. Offered with no forward chain

Location

Set within a quiet cul-de-sac in Romsey, the shops, cafes and restaurants of the town centre are only a short distance down a pleasant canal walk. All main transport rail and road links are close at hand and there is a well-stocked convenience store also within walking distance. Accessed via a pedestrian pathway, the frontage has been mainly laid to lawn with a selection of mature shrubs and plants bordering. There is a pedestrian pathway which leads to a fitted storage cupboard and the front door.

Summary

This one-bedroom ground floor maisonette is positioned in a quiet cul-de-sac that includes an allocated parking space, spacious living/dining area, kitchen with space for under counter fridge, freezer, washing machine and oven, double bedroom with fitted storage and fitted bathroom. Overlooking a quiet green open space to the front.

Agent Notes

Lease -- 78 years remaining
Ground Rent -- £150 per annum
Building Insurance -- £260.81 per annum
